Cancellation And Withdrawal
Effective date: August 7, 2026
Landly's current Open Beta is free and capacity-limited. There is no public paid checkout, subscription, recurring charge, or paid order during this phase, so there is no current Landly charge to refund. The zero-price contract formed in onboarding is recorded as the Free Early Access Terms.
Why This Page Exists For A Free Service
A payment-refund policy is not operative while Landly charges EUR 0. This page remains available because ending the contract, exercising a statutory withdrawal right where one applies, and requesting deletion of personal data are different actions. It explains those choices without suggesting that a payment was made.

Current Free Open Beta
While capacity is available, registration and confirmed-email activation create a free account without payment or manual invitation review. The free Open Beta is a temporary release phase, but it has no announced calendar end date or per-user countdown. Closing registration later does not by itself end access already granted. Free access is not promised permanently and may end under the Terms with the required notice. A legacy waitlist request does not reserve a place, authorize payment, or convert automatically into a paid service.
Pricing information is not publicly available during the current Free Open Beta. A future paid offer requires a separate reviewed launch and an explicit purchase action; it cannot change the terms you accepted for free Early Access automatically.
Ending Early Access
There is no minimum term. You may stop using Landly and terminate the free Early Access contract at any time through the account deletion flow or by emailing support@landly.to. Account deletion ends Early Access but is not itself a statutory withdrawal statement. Termination, withdrawal, and deletion of personal data are separate legal actions.
14-Day Withdrawal Right
Where mandatory EU or national consumer law applies, you may withdraw from the Early Access contract within 14 days after it is concluded, without giving a reason and without cost. Asking Landly to start the free service immediately does not waive mandatory withdrawal rights.
To withdraw online, use the continuously available Withdraw from contract here function. It lets you confirm your name, the Early Access contract, and the contract email used for the durable receipt before the final confirmation action. You may sign in or use the secure contract-specific link in your Terms confirmation email; that link remains usable after account deletion.
You may alternatively email support@landly.toor send another unambiguous statement before the deadline. Optional model wording: "I hereby withdraw from my Landly Free Early Access contract concluded on [date], for account email [email]."
Withdrawal ends the service contract and Landly may disable access. Because the agreed Early Access price is EUR 0, there is no Landly payment to reimburse. Your privacy rights, including deletion where available, remain separate.

Before Any Future Paid Launch
Before enabling any payment, Landly will publish and present the applicable cancellation, withdrawal, and refund information, mandatory consumer notices, and purchase terms. Those future documents will apply only after a user takes an explicit paid purchase action. They will not replace the current free Early Access withdrawal information.
